0

我有一个 JSF 数据表,它有三列,它们是:Work_Type_Desc、Project_Phase 和 Activity_Desc。这些列来自 2 个不同的数据库表,这两个表的关系是一对多的。

第一个表名称是 Work_Type。它有 1) Work_Type_Cd、2)Work_Type_Desc、3)Created_By_Name、4)Created_DT、5)Updated_By_Name、6) Updated_DT

第二个表名称是 Activity_Type。它有 1)Activity_Cd、2) Work_Type_Cd、3)Project_Phase、4)Activity_Desc、5)Created_By_Name、6)Created_DT、7)Updated_By_Name、8) Updated_DT。

我使用 Hibernate+Spring+JSF,我之前的问题是如何在 JSF 数据表中显示这三列记录,在这里的一个好人的帮助下已经解决了, 来自多个数据库表的 JSF 数据表列

现在,我有一个新问题,我现在可以在 JSF 页面中显示所有现有记录并添加新记录。但是删除和更新时有问题。这是我的删除代码,我已经将级联设置为全部,因为我需要做所有的CRUD:

adminService.deleteActivity((String[]) dataTable.getRowData()); allActivity = adminService.findAllActivityTypes();

但它不起作用,你知道如何解决它吗?谢谢!

4

0 回答 0